Improper Drill Bit Selection

One of the main reasons for drill bit breakage is using the wrong type of bit for the material being drilled. Different materials require different types of drill bits. For example, a wood drill bit cannot be used to drill through metal. Using the wrong bit can cause the bit to bind or wear out quickly, leading to breakage. It is important to choose the appropriate drill bit for the specific material you are drilling into.

Additionally, using a dull or damaged drill bit can also lead to breakage. When a drill bit is not sharp, it can cause excessive heat and friction, which weakens the bit and makes it more prone to breaking. Regularly inspect and replace worn-out or damaged drill bits to ensure optimal performance and prevent breakage.

Inadequate Speed and Pressure

Another common cause of drill bit breakage is using incorrect speed and pressure while drilling. When drilling into different materials, it is important to adjust the speed and pressure accordingly. Too high of a speed or excessive pressure can cause the bit to overheat, leading to breakage.

When drilling through hard materials, such as metal or concrete, it is recommended to use a slower speed and apply steady, even pressure. On the other hand, softer materials like wood may require a higher speed but still maintain moderate pressure to prevent the bit from getting stuck or snapping.

It is also crucial to let the drill bit do the work and avoid forcing it through the material. Pushing too hard or using excessive force puts unnecessary strain on the bit, increasing the chances of breakage. Remember to maintain a consistent speed and pressure throughout the drilling process to ensure the longevity of your drill bits.

Poor Lubrication and Cooling

Lack of lubrication and cooling can also cause drill bit breakage, especially when drilling into certain materials. For example, when drilling through metal, the friction can generate a significant amount of heat, which can weaken the bit and eventually cause it to break.

To prevent overheating and breakage, it is essential to lubricate the drill bit with cutting oil or a lubricating spray specifically designed for drilling. This helps reduce friction and heat buildup, allowing the bit to move smoothly through the material. Additionally, using a coolant or applying a steady stream of water while drilling can further enhance cooling and prevent heat-related breakage.

Before starting any drilling project, consider the material being drilled and choose the appropriate lubricant or coolant for optimal performance and longevity of the drill bits.

4. Are there any warning signs that indicate a drill bit may break soon?

Yes, there are some warning signs that suggest a drill bit may be nearing the end of its lifespan and could potentially break soon. One sign is a decrease in cutting performance. If you notice that the drill is not cutting through the material as easily or efficiently as it used to, it could indicate that the bit is becoming dull or damaged.

Another warning sign is visible wear or damage on the drill bit. Look for chipping, cracking, or any other visible signs of wear that could compromise the integrity of the bit. If you notice any of these signs, it is best to replace the drill bit to avoid potential breakage during drilling.

5. Are there any maintenance tips to extend the life of drill bits?

Yes, proper maintenance can help extend the life of your drill bits. One essential tip is to clean the drill bits after each use to remove any debris or residue that may have built up during drilling. This can help prevent overheating and ensure optimal performance.

Additionally, it is essential to store your drill bits in a dry and clean environment to protect them from corrosion or damage. Avoid tossing them in a toolbox where they can bump against other tools, as this may cause chipping or dulling of the cutting edges. Regularly inspect your drill bits for signs of wear or damage, and replace them as needed. Taking these precautions will help prolong the life of your drill bits and maintain their effectiveness.
